Unlocking Property Records at Your Fingertips: A Guide to Free Access
In today's digital age, information is readily available at our fingertips. This includes property records, which are essential for homebuyers. Luckily, you don't need to scour complicated systems to access this valuable information. Numerous accessible online resources provide swift access to property records, making the process simple.
- Delve into your local government's website. Many counties and cities offer online portals where you can browse public records, including property deeds, tax assessments, and ownership history.
- Utilize dedicated property record websites. Several platforms specialize in aggregating and organizing property data from various sources. These sites often provide user-friendly interfaces and advanced search options.
- Keep in mind some records may be restricted. You may need to request a formal form for certain types of information.
By embracing these free resources, you can equip yourself with the knowledge needed to make informed decisions about property.
Unlocking the Potential of Public Property Records
Public property records serve as a vital repository for understanding land ownership and property history. These comprehensive databases contain invaluable data on real estate transactions, building permits, assessments, and other crucial details. By leveraging the power of public property records, individuals, businesses, and governmental agencies can gain a wealth of knowledge to drive informed decisions in various domains.
From researching property appraisals for investment purposes to uncovering historical shifts in land use, public property records provide a unique window into the evolution of communities. Moreover, they play a critical role in ensuring accountability in real estate transactions and protecting against fraud.
- Investigating property records can reveal valuable data points about neighborhood demographics, economic growth, and environmental characteristics.
- Investigators utilize property records to track criminals, investigate incidents, and secure documentation related to property-related offenses.
- Historians leverage property records to reconstruct the history of communities, understand past urban development, and shed light on social changes.
